/* styles written in this file is for Standard */



.priest{
	background-image:	url(../_img/pag_ttl.jpg);
}

.priest-index .main-contents{
	width:			700px;
	margin:			0px auto;
	padding-top:		248px;
}



.priest-index .portrait{
	margin:			0px;
	padding:		0px;
	width:			201px;
	float:			right;
}

.priest-index .portrait h2{
	margin:			0px;
	padding:		0px 0px 10px 0px;
}

.priest-index .portrait p{
	margin:			0px;
	padding:		0px;
	font-size:		12px;
	color:			#333333;
	line-height:		1.6;
}

.priest-index .profile{
	margin:			0px;
	padding:		0px;
	width:			499px;
	float:			right;
}

.priest-index .profile .lead{
	margin:			0px;
	padding:		0px 20px 30px 0px;
}

.priest-index .profile .lead p{
	margin:			0px;
	padding:		0px;
	font-size:		12px;
	color:			#333333;
	line-height:		1.6;
}

.priest-index .profile .lead p em{
	font-size:		10px;
	font-style:		normal;
}

.priest-index .profile .history{
	margin:			0px;
	padding:		0px 0px 30px 0px;
}

.priest-index .profile .history h2{
	margin:			0px;
	padding:		0px;
}

.priest-index .profile .history table{
	margin:			0px;
	width:			467px;
	border-collapse:	collapse;
}

.priest-index .profile .history table tr th,
.priest-index .profile .history table tr td{
	padding:		2px 0px;
	font-size:		12px;
	color:			#333333;
	line-height:		1.6;
	font-weight:		normal;
	background-image:	url(../_img/ind_pro_01_tab_sep.gif);
	background-repeat:	repeat-x;
	background-position:	bottom left;
}

.priest-index .profile .history table tr th span{
	display:		none;
}

.priest-index .profile .history table tr th.year{
	width:			82px;
}

.priest-index .profile .history table tr th.month{
	width:			52px;
}

.priest-index .commercial{
	margin:			0px;
	padding:		0px;
}

.priest-index .commercial h2{
	margin:			0px;
	padding:		0px 0px 10px 0px;
}

.priest-index .commercial h3{
	position:		absolute;
	left:			-5000px;
	top:			-5000px;
}

.priest-index .commercial .movie{
	margin:			0px;
	padding:		0px 0px 0px 237px;
	background-image:	url(../_img/ind_pro_02_img_01.jpg);
	background-repeat:	no-repeat;
}

.priest-index .commercial .movie h3{
	margin:			0px;
	padding:		0px 0px 10px 0px;
}

.priest-index .commercial .movie p{
	margin:			0px 0px 10px 0px;
	padding:		0px;
	font-size:		12px;
	color:			#333333;
	line-height:		1.6;
}

.priest-index .commercial .movie p a:link,
.priest-index .commercial .movie p a:visited,
.priest-index .commercial .movie p a:hover,
.priest-index .commercial .movie p a:active{
	font-size:		12px;
	color:			#333333;
	line-height:		1.6;
}
























